Do bees remember you?

Bees may have brains the size of poppy seeds, but they’re able to pick out individual features on human faces and recognize them during repeat interactions.

Can bees sense human emotions?

When humans or other animals are scared, we release the fear pheromone. Consequently, bees can smell these chemicals our bodies release. Individual bees that detect the fear pheromone communicate quickly to nearby bees about the threat.

What powers do bees have?

They have Superman-like strength and endurance

Okay, they’re no match for Superman, but on average, a bee is able to carry 71 times its own weight. Even more impressive, while airborne, it can even carry up to its own weight in pollen and nectar (albeit clumsily). Bees are also more fuel efficient than any hybrid.

What attracts a bee to a human?

If you look or smell like a flower, you are more likely to attract the attention of a bee. They love the smell of some sunscreens, shampoos, perfumes and aftershaves. They also love flowery prints and shiny jewelry and buckles. That’s why beekeepers wear white, without accessories.
